首页 话题 小组 问答 好文 用户 我的社区 域名交易 唠叨

[教程]掌握Java onsubmit:轻松实现表单提交全攻略

发布于 2025-06-23 17:42:12
0
1115

引言在Web开发中,表单提交是一个基本且重要的功能。Java作为后端开发的主流语言之一,经常需要与表单交互。了解如何在Java中处理表单提交对于开发者来说至关重要。本文将深入探讨Java中的onsub...

引言

在Web开发中,表单提交是一个基本且重要的功能。Java作为后端开发的主流语言之一,经常需要与表单交互。了解如何在Java中处理表单提交对于开发者来说至关重要。本文将深入探讨Java中的onsubmit事件,帮助开发者轻松实现表单提交。

什么是onsubmit

onsubmit是一个JavaScript事件,当用户提交表单时触发。在Java中,通常与HTML表单结合使用,用于在表单提交之前执行一些验证或逻辑处理。

如何在Java中使用onsubmit

在Java中,可以使用JavaScript和HTML来添加onsubmit事件处理程序。以下是如何实现的步骤:

步骤1:创建HTML表单

首先,你需要创建一个HTML表单。以下是一个简单的表单示例:

步骤2:添加JavaScript处理程序

接下来,在HTML文件中添加一个

步骤3:将onsubmit事件附加到表单

onsubmit事件附加到表单元素上:

步骤4:处理提交逻辑

handleFormSubmit函数中,你可以添加任何你需要在表单提交之前执行的逻辑,例如验证输入数据。如果验证失败,你可以返回false以阻止表单提交:

function handleFormSubmit(event) { var username = document.getElementById('username').value; var password = document.getElementById('password').value; if (username.length === 0 || password.length === 0) { alert('用户名和密码不能为空!'); return false; } // 如果验证通过,则允许表单提交 return true;
}

Java后端处理

一旦表单数据通过前端验证并成功提交,它将发送到服务器。在Java后端,你可以使用Servlet或其他框架来处理这些数据。

以下是一个简单的Servlet示例,用于处理表单提交:

@WebServlet("/submit")
public class FormSubmitServlet extends HttpServlet { protected void doPost(HttpServletRequest request, HttpServletResponse response) throws ServletException, IOException { String username = request.getParameter("username"); String password = request.getParameter("password"); // 处理表单数据 // ... response.setContentType("text/html"); PrintWriter out = response.getWriter(); out.println("

表单提交成功

"); } }

总结

通过结合JavaScript和Java,你可以轻松地在Web应用中实现表单提交。理解并掌握onsubmit事件的使用,可以帮助你创建更健壮和用户友好的表单。

评论
一个月内的热帖推荐
csdn大佬
Lv.1普通用户

452398

帖子

22

小组

841

积分

赞助商广告
站长交流